A Mediational Model of Autonomy, Self-Esteem, and Eating Disordered Attitudes and Behaviors.
Frederick, Christina M.; Grow, Virginia M.
Psychology of Women Quarterly, v20 n2 p217-28 Jun 1996
Findings from a study of the relationships among autonomy deficits, low self-esteem, and eating disorders of 71 college women supported a mediational model in which lack of autonomy was related to decreased global self-esteem, which in turn was associated with bulimia and body dissatisfaction.
